Key Responsibilities of a Production Planner
. Ensure work is loaded in the most efficient manner, maintaining customer delivery dates.
. Maintain up to date tracking of live works orders.
. Produce weekly and monthly forward loading for machining and finishing operations, including deburring, inspection, packing and despatch.
. Monitor progress against the production schedule, working closely with CNC machinists to proactively manage delays and maintain output targets.
. Physically move jobs through production processes in a timely manner.
. Ensure subcontract requirements and raw materials are issued and allocated correctly and on time.
. Maintain accurate Bills of Materials, including set and cycle times.
. Identify production constraints within CNC machining and wider manufacturing processes, working with shop floor teams to resolve issues.
. Monitor KPIs, production performance and drive continuous improvement initiatives.
. Complete administration within SAGE 200 and Preactor systems.
. Ensure compliance with quality standards, including ISO 13485.
